The Spectrum of Brown: From Deep Espresso to Creamy Beige
Not all browns are created equal. The beauty of brown paint lies in its versatility across the brown pigment spectrum. Here are some popular tones that appeal to different design tastes:
- Espresso / Deep Brown: A striking, bold choice for dramatic accent walls or feature spaces. This rich, saturated hue adds depth and drama while still feeling grounded.
- Chocolate Brown: A warm, medium tone that balances richness with comfort. Ideal for family homes, zero-gravity seating areas, or elegant contemporary spaces.
- Chamois / Warm Taupe: A softer, cream-toned brown that adds softness and warmth without overwhelming the eye. Perfect for bringing calm and serenity to minimalist interiors.
- Cedar / Warm Oak: With hints of honey and amber, these variants evoke forest vibes and natural beauty, perfect for cabin-inspired or coastal decor.
Each shade brings its own personality—allowing homeowners to choose based on the mood, lighting, and style of their space.

Practical Applications of Brown Paint
Brown’s enduring popularity shines through its wide range of practical applications:
- Walls: A neutral brown paint absorbs sound, enhances thermal comfort, and pairs beautifully with natural textures like wood and stone.
- Cabinetry & Furniture: Whether in kitchens, stairs, or built-in shelving, brown enhances wooden surfaces and elevates architectural details.
- Accent Walls: A single warm brown accent wall can serve as a stunning focal point in living rooms, bedrooms, or entryways.
- Exterior & Fence Paint: Outdoor-grade brown paints offer durable, weather-resistant color for decks, fences, and garden structures—blending aesthetics with function.
Benefits of Choosing Brown Paint
Beyond aesthetics, choosing brown paint comes with several functional advantages:
- Timelessness: Unlike fleeting trends, brown remains stylish across decades.
- Versatility: Easily paired with whites, golds, neutrals, greens, and even muted blues.
- Psychological Warmth: Browns are linked to comfort, security, and reliability—creating emotionally welcoming spaces.
- Eco-Friendly Options: Many modern paint brands offer low-VOC and natural earth-based brown formulations for healthier indoor air quality.
